Regular health check-ups are an essential part of maintaining good health. They can help detect potential health problems early, when they are most treatable. Here are some reasons why regular health check-ups are important:
Regular health check-ups can help detect potential health problems early, before they become more serious. This can include conditions like high blood pressure, high cholesterol, and diabetes. Early detection can lead to more effective treatment and better outcomes.
Regular health check-ups can also include preventive care, such as vaccinations and cancer screenings. Preventive care can help prevent serious health problems from developing in the first place.
If you have a chronic condition like diabetes or heart disease, regular health check-ups are essential for managing your condition. Your doctor can monitor your condition and adjust your treatment plan as needed.
Regular health check-ups can also include mental health screenings. Mental health screenings can help detect conditions like depression and anxiety early, when they are most treatable.
Regular health check-ups can help you maintain overall well-being. Your doctor can provide guidance on healthy lifestyle choices, such as diet and exercise, and help you develop a plan to achieve your health goals.
In conclusion, regular health check-ups are an essential part of maintaining good health. They can help detect potential health problems early, provide preventive care, manage chronic conditions, and promote overall well-being.
